HTTPConduit reads response before it completes sending request

Hi,

  In CXF 2.4, HTTP Conduit has a new debug log as below. However, this logging 
message can cause HTTPConduit reads the  response before it completes sending 
request, and it results in an IOException in the client side.
  The reason is that the method *connection.getContentType()* will trigger 
httpconnect to send current data to the HttpServer and want the server to 
return the response, so the server thinks the client complete the whole request 
and the server just reply nothing and closes the http connection.


Code in HttpConduit.java
{code}
        protected void onFirstWrite() throws IOException {
            ...            
            if (LOG.isLoggable(Level.FINE)) {
                LOG.fine("Sending "
                    + connection.getRequestMethod() 
                    + " Message with Headers to " 
                    + connection.getURL()
                    + " Conduit :"
                    + conduitName
                    + "\nContent-Type: " + connection.getContentType() + "\n");
            }
        }
{code}

  To reproduce the issue: please create a simple web service in cxf 2.4 and 
enable its debug log, and then use a generated proxy client to call the http 
service, then you can see the error below.
